Boeing [BA] July 17 said it opened a state-of-the-art Information Security Innovation Lab in Huntington Beach, Calif., that will be used to prototype innovative cyber security technologies using live networks in a secure yet real-world environment. "Boeing has made substantial investments in cyber security research and development over the past several years, including opening our Cyber Engagement Center in Maryland and completing numerous acquisitions," said Boeing Information Security Solutions Director Per Beith.
